2026/4/18 10:30:50
网站建设
项目流程
深圳做营销网站设计,几个有效网址谢谢,泰州住房城乡建设网站,长沙企业网站开发抖音直播录制终极指南#xff1a;从单场录制到24小时自动采集系统 【免费下载链接】douyin-downloader 项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ader
在内容创作和电商运营领域#xff0c;错过直播精彩瞬间意味着失去宝贵的素材资源。传统录…抖音直播录制终极指南从单场录制到24小时自动采集系统【免费下载链接】douyin-downloader项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ader在内容创作和电商运营领域错过直播精彩瞬间意味着失去宝贵的素材资源。传统录屏工具不仅操作繁琐还面临画质压缩和无法多任务并行的技术瓶颈。本文将通过专业级抖音直播录制工具为你构建完整的自动化采集解决方案实现24小时不间断监控和高清素材获取。技术架构优势为什么选择专业录制方案传统录屏方式依赖系统截图功能导致画质严重损失且无法后台运行。而专业录制工具直接获取直播源流支持1080P原画质保存通过多线程并发处理实现高效稳定运行。核心技术突破点直播流直接采集绕过录屏环节直接从抖音服务器获取高清视频流智能并发控制通过队列管理和速率限制确保系统稳定性自动化身份认证集成Cookie管理和自动更新机制多策略下载模式支持API直连和浏览器模拟双模式切换环境部署5分钟快速搭建录制系统项目获取与依赖安装git clone https://gitcode.com/GitHub_Trending/do/douyin-downloader cd douyin-downloader pip install -r requirements.txt核心依赖包括流媒体处理、网络请求优化和数据库存储模块确保直播数据稳定接收和高效管理。配置文件初始化项目提供多种配置模板推荐使用config_douyin.yml作为基础配置# 基础配置示例 download: quality: 1080p threads: 5 retry_times: 3 live_recording: enabled: true auto_restart: true segment_duration: 3600单场直播录制实战操作命令行快速启动使用核心脚本开始单场直播录制python DouYinCommand.py -l 直播间链接 --mode live --quality 1080p抖音直播录制功能界面 - 展示直播间信息获取和多清晰度选择系统执行后自动完成以下流程链接解析识别直播间ID和相关信息状态检测确认直播是否在线及观众数量清晰度选择提供FULL_HD1、SD1、SD2等多个选项流地址提取获取直播源地址并开始录制录制参数优化建议参数类型推荐值效果说明清晰度FULL_HD1最高画质录制线程数3-5平衡性能与稳定性自动分段3600秒避免单文件过大便于管理批量监控多直播间同步录制方案智能配置文件设计对于需要同时监控多个直播间的场景创建专用配置文件live_channels: - url: https://live.douyin.com/273940655995 quality: 1080p save_path: ./recordings/channel1 max_duration: 7200 - url: https://live.douyin.com/另一个直播间 quality: 720p save_path: ./recordings/channel2 auto_restart: true批量录制启动命令python DouYinCommand.py -F config_live.yml批量下载进度追踪界面 - 显示多线程并发录制状态和完成情况系统为每个直播间创建独立录制任务实时显示下载进度每个任务的完成百分比时间统计预计剩余时间和实际耗时文件管理自动分类存储和命名高级应用24小时自动化采集系统系统定时任务配置通过crontab实现全自动运行# 每小时检查一次直播状态 0 * * * * cd /path/to/douyin-downloader python DouYinCommand.py --mode auto智能调度算法实现class LiveMonitorScheduler: def __init__(self): self.active_channels [] self.recording_status {} def monitor_live_status(self, channel_url): 监控直播间状态变化 # 检测直播是否开始 # 自动启动录制任务 # 处理异常中断和自动恢复性能优化与稳定性保障资源调配最佳实践内存管理设置合理的缓冲区大小推荐8192字节磁盘空间监控存储空间自动清理过期文件网络优化配置重试机制和超时时间并发处理能力提升通过队列管理器优化多任务调度# 核心并发控制逻辑 queue_manager QueueManager(max_concurrent5) rate_limiter RateLimiter(requests_per_second2)行业应用场景深度解析电商运营素材体系建设构建完整的商品展示资料库产品演示归档按品牌、品类建立分类体系销售话术分析提取关键营销节点和转化策略竞品监控分析跟踪同行直播动态和促销活动内容创作灵感捕捉热点话题追踪实时记录行业讨论和用户反馈创意表现形式学习优秀直播的视觉设计和互动方式用户行为洞察分析观众互动模式和关注点变化故障排除与维护指南常见问题快速解决方案录制中断恢复流程检查网络连接状态运行Cookie更新脚本python cookie_extractor.py监控系统资源使用情况系统健康检查清单Cookie有效性验证磁盘空间充足性检查网络连接稳定性测试录制文件完整性验证扩展集成与自定义开发第三方工具链集成支持与主流媒体处理工具对接FFmpeg集成视频格式转换和剪辑处理数据库存储录制元数据持久化保存API接口开发为其他系统提供数据服务个性化录制规则定制根据不同业务需求调整录制策略def custom_recording_policy(business_type): 业务定制化录制策略 policies { 电商直播: { segment_interval: 1800, quality_priority: 1080p, metadata_fields: [product_info, promotion_details] }, 教育培训: { segment_interval: 3600, quality_priority: 720p, metadata_fields: [course_content, interaction_log] } } return policies.get(business_type, {})成果验证与持续优化经过实际测试验证该方案具备以下技术指标录制成功率超过95%并发处理能力支持10个直播间同时监控画质保障稳定录制1080P高清视频系统稳定性24小时不间断运行维护建议每周执行一次系统检查及时更新工具版本保持身份认证有效性确保长期稳定运行。通过本文介绍的完整方案你可以快速搭建专业的直播录制系统掌握从基础操作到高级应用的各项技能为内容创作和商业运营提供强有力的技术支撑。【免费下载链接】douyin-downloader项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考